"The biography of a person never be complete, if not describe the physical and social environment in which he lived. My son Ernesto lived in Alta Gracia from age five to sixteen. Throughout his childhood and adolescence. "
.

Alta Gracia View the Sierras Hotel
(Actual Street Avellaneda)
(...)
"I had rented an old chalet style house which bore the name of Villa Nydia, owned by gaucho Lozada a descendant of illustrious countryman Cordoba who was also owner of the church and the parsonage, now a historic monument. "

Villa Nydia (first house on the left)
.
(...)
"At the back of our house had a field of more than one hectare. As we grew was not always covered with weeds, which is why neither Celia and I used to go there.
I remember that at that time (since 36 to 39) was fighting in Spain. It was a civil war that lasted almost three years, and as I supported the English Republican movement in Argentina, our conversations about the war were daily and that is why our children were aware of every detail and played at the "English War." Ernesto devised to build in that area truncheras line dug in the ground and interconnected by underground passageways. I knew nothing about what kids were doing at the ground and when I heard, I immediately realized the danger that the brats had been, it could be a landslide while building the trenches.
But anyway, nothing happened and instead allowed them to have fun and train as future combatants. "
